Transaction 81e121675dbe10e506ee8d83a63f20f1bc50f5c255da1e8b9036aa7e98f808e8

1 Input
2 Outputs
  • 81e121675dbe10e506ee8d83a63f20f1bc50f5c255da1e8b9036aa7e98f808e8:0
  • value  46000000
    address  1DKMBcFGZBBfkxBTaVeVtGUZFrRbjNnt5X
  • 81e121675dbe10e506ee8d83a63f20f1bc50f5c255da1e8b9036aa7e98f808e8:1
  • value  175236382
    address  12LKyX1gPS13SqkUSJmfSFkYrPj1KntyGM